Who helped Ukraine the most?

In absolute terms, the largest supporter as of October 3 – by a very large margin – was the United States, with a total of €52.3 billion made up of €27.6 billion in military aid, €9.5 billion humanitarian aid and €15.2 billion in financial aid.

How many weapons has France sent to Ukraine

Since Russia’s invasion in February, France has sent Ukraine 18 Caesar units, a 155-mm howitzer mounted on a six-wheeled truck chassis, capable of firing shells at ranges of more than 40 kilometres (25 miles).

Which countries are sending tanks to Ukraine

Kyiv will get 90 T-72 tanks, donated by the Czech Republic and upgraded with U.S. and Dutch funds. The United States is helping to pay for refurbished tanks for Ukraine and sending more anti-aircraft systems and electrical-power gear, Pentagon and White House officials said Friday.

Is the US sending helicopters to Ukraine?

The United States is giving Ukraine 16 Mi-17 helicopters that Washington had procured for Afghanistan, a U.S. government agency charged with monitoring Afghan events said Wednesday.

What weapons has Canada sent to Ukraine

Canada has shipped ammunition, anti-tank rounds, grenades, M72 rocket launchers and small arms to Ukraine from its own stocks as the European country fights off a Russian invasion. Canada also provided four M777 howitzers and 100 older-generation Carl Gustaf M2 recoilless rifles.
